The original Shokz OpenRun Pros may have been knocked off our list of the best running headphones by their successor, the OpenRun Pro 2s, but this 2022 pair still has a ton to offer. They’re great for hitting the road or the trails thanks to the unique bone-conduction technology, which delivers sound through your cheekbone so you can enjoy your music anywhere without sacrificing situational awareness.
They’re comfortable and lightweight at just 29 grams, and the wraparound frame will keep them securely in place during your workouts. Plus, they’ve got an IP55 water- and dust-resistance rating, so a little rain or sweat won’t damage them, and they also have an impressive 10-hour battery life for all-day training.
